With a specialty in energy systems and sustainability, M.K. is a skilled energy and infrastructure project manager with 10 years’ multidisciplinary experience in engineering, project delivery, and construction oversight of complex projects. At Community Power, M.K. is responsible for overseeing technical aspects and ensuring the technical integrity of projects and programs; identifying and diagnosing energy efficiency opportunities; and, continually reviewing and implementing best practices wherever possible.
M.K. holds a Master of Engineering Leaders in Clean Energy Engineering from the University of British Columbia and a Bachelor of Applied Science in Mechanical Engineering (Business Administration Minor) from the University of Windsor. He is also a Project Management Professional and is a registered Professional Engineer with the Engineers and Geoscientists of BC.
Prior to joining Community Power, M.K. was a Clean Energy Project Researcher with the Clean Energy Research Centre at the University of British Columbia, and a Mechanical Systems and Project Engineer and Nuclear Plant Design Engineer with Bechtel in Canada.
